aboutsummaryrefslogtreecommitdiffstats
path: root/main/arpwatch/11_all_arpwatch-2.1a15-secure-tmp.patch
blob: 4e9cd88b8ad3d7550fd17cfcded4f6d0e59b0c5c (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
diff -Naru arpwatch-2.1a15.orig/bihourly.sh arpwatch-2.1a15/bihourly.sh
--- arpwatch-2.1a15.orig/bihourly.sh	2006-07-28 22:19:45.000000000 +0400
+++ arpwatch-2.1a15/bihourly.sh	2006-09-22 21:29:38.000000000 +0400
@@ -10,8 +10,8 @@
 #
 list="`cat list`"
 cname="`cat cname`"
-temp1=/tmp/bihourly.1.$$
-temp2=/tmp/bihourly.2.$$
+temp1=$(mktemp)
+temp2=$(mktemp)
 d=/tmp/errs
 
 # imperfect hack
diff -Naru arpwatch-2.1a15.orig/mkdep arpwatch-2.1a15/mkdep
--- arpwatch-2.1a15.orig/mkdep	1996-06-23 13:25:24.000000000 +0400
+++ arpwatch-2.1a15/mkdep	2006-09-22 21:30:04.000000000 +0400
@@ -51,7 +51,7 @@
 	exit 1
 fi
 
-TMP=/tmp/mkdep$$
+TMP=$(mktemp)
 
 trap 'rm -f $TMP ; exit 1' 1 2 3 13 15